What's The Definition Of Lowbred?
[adj] (of persons) lacking in refinement or grace
Synonyms | Synonyms for Lowbred: bounderish | ill-bred | rude | underbred | unrefined | yokelish Related Terms | Find terms related to Lowbred: See Also | Lowbred In Webster's Dictionary \Low"bred`\, a.
Bred, or like one bred, in a low condition of life;
characteristic or indicative of such breeding; rude;
impolite; vulgar; as, a lowbred fellow; a lowbred remark.
